Output 04707937c67b161d25c812c9b6abdbfd5493b72e171c9539fb6367ad131caf9e:2

value
69021
script pubkey
OP_0 OP_PUSHBYTES_20 75ff754079de652d3eb5dc7f575b758973dda078
address
bc1qwhlh2sremejj6044m3l4wkm439eamgrcmtk3kj
transaction
04707937c67b161d25c812c9b6abdbfd5493b72e171c9539fb6367ad131caf9e
confirmations
73652
spent
true